LY53 ZYA is a 2004 Renault Scenic in Red with a 1,598c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 21 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 57.1%.
Across all 2004 Renault Scenic models, the average MOT pass rate is 68.1% with a typical mileage of 40,000 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Renault Scenic f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 108,325 recorded failures. If you're considering buying LY53 ZYA,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Renault Scenic typically stays on UK roads for around 26 years. At 22 years old, this Renault Scenic is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
